9.10.5. IIR Filter Tuning Parameters

Table 21.  IIR Filter Tuning Parameters
Parameter Description
Ωd Corner frequency (rad/s) above which the denominator response magnitude begins to decrease.
ζd Damping factor that determines the sharpness of the corner at Ωd; ζd < sqrt(0.5) results in a filter response peak (filter resonance) around Ωd, whereas ζd > sqrt(0.5) gives a more gradual (more strongly damped) transition with no peak.
Ωn Corner frequency (rad/s) above which the numerator response magnitude begins to increase.
ζn Damping factor that determines the sharpness of the corner at Ωn; ζn < sqrt(0.5) results in a filter response trough around Ωn, whereas ζn > sqrt(0.5) gives a more gradual transition with no trough.

Use these four parameters to create different filter response shapes. For vibration suppression, use a notch characteristic to decrease the system gain only around the frequency of interest. Set Ωn = Ωd and ζn < ζd. The gain at Ωn = Ωd is then equal to 
ζn/ ζd
